Abstract

The invention relates to a beginner standard pen prompting method, which is characterized by comprising the following steps: the stress end of the pen core, which is opposite to the pen point, on the intelligent pen is provided with the film pressure sensor, and the stress condition of the pen core is collected by the film pressure sensor, so that the tension of the pen used by a beginner is judged, and then the intelligent pen is reminded. The pen using reminding device skillfully reminds the user of using the pen in a standard manner by detecting the force of using the pen by the beginner, not only can greatly improve the pen using habit of the user, but also can provide help for the user to quickly master the pen using.

Detailed Description
The present invention is further illustrated by the following specific examples.
The embodiment provides a beginner standard pen using prompting method, which is characterized in that a pressure sensor is arranged at a stress end of a pen core opposite to a pen point on an intelligent pen, and the stress condition of the pen core is collected through the pressure sensor to judge the tension of the pen used by the beginner so as to remind the student. It is worth mentioning here that the force-bearing end of the pen core comprises a pen core tail part and a surface of the pen core telescoping mechanism contacting with the pen core tail part, but is not limited thereto.
In this embodiment, preferably, the pressure sensor is a film pressure sensor, and may be a film pressure sensor/a 101/flexiforce, a film pressure sensor/a 201/flexiforce or a film pressure sensor/a 301/flexiforce; and is not limited thereto.
Referring to fig. 1 to 3, the structure of the smart pen provided by the present invention is as follows: the intelligent pen is provided with a pen core telescopic mechanism and a control circuit, wherein the control circuit comprises an MCU processing unit, and a touch sensor, an angle sensor, a distance sensor, a light sensor, a timing module, a storage unit, a pen core movement execution module, a prompt module, a film pressure sensor and a wireless transmission module which are connected with the MCU processing unit. In this embodiment, the film pressure sensor may be an inching film pressure sensor. The refill telescopic mechanism can adopt a crankshaft connecting rod, a reciprocating screw rod or a rotary screw rod; and are not intended to be limiting herein.
The movement execution module is used for driving a refill telescoping mechanism, the refill telescoping mechanism comprises a motor base 1 fixedly connected to the inner wall of a pen body, a working motor 2 coaxially arranged with the pen body is arranged on the motor base, a reciprocating screw rod 3 is fixedly connected to an output shaft of the working motor, the reciprocating screw rod is connected with a sleeve 4 used for arranging a refill through a screw rod nut pair structure, a film pressure sensor is arranged on the inner wall (not shown in the figure) of the bottom of the sleeve 4, and when the tail end of the refill is sleeved in the sleeve, the film pressure sensor collects extrusion force between the tail end of the refill and the inner wall of the bottom of the sleeve; two spaced notches 7 are arranged on the upper part of the sleeve along the moving direction of the sleeve, and an optical switch 6 which is fixedly arranged on the inner wall of the pen body and is connected with a working motor circuit is arranged above the sleeve between the two notches.
Referring to fig. 3, in order to ensure that the sleeve can freely reciprocate on the reciprocating screw rod, an arc-shaped buckle 5 is arranged on the side wall of the upper part of the sleeve, a guide post 8 with one end part positioned in the thread of the reciprocating screw rod penetrates through the arc-shaped buckle, and the arc-shaped buckle is fixedly connected with the sleeve through two locking screws 9.
Referring to fig. 2, in order to ensure that the movement between the sleeve and the inner wall of the pen body does not run off, the walls of the two sides of the sleeve are respectively provided with a bump 10 for limiting and guiding, and considering pen cores with different outer diameters, the walls of the sleeve are also provided with an elastic clip 11 for clamping the pen cores with different outer diameters.
In order to achieve a relatively good control effect, the optical switch is a gp2s60b reflective optical switch. It is noted that a person skilled in the art may also use a magnet to trigger the hall switch to achieve the above-mentioned optical switch effect, which belongs to the equivalent alternative of the present application.
In an embodiment of the invention, the intelligent pen is provided with a display screen, the reminding is displayed on the display screen in a text form, and the reminding can be used as reminding by the brightness of the display screen to remind a user that the display screen has a text reminding. The characters can be 'too strong force with a pen, please relax', the test value of the pressure and the range of the standard value can be displayed on the display screen, so that the user can compare the values by himself or herself. In the embodiment, the pen is normally used when the weight of the pen point is 50-150 g, and the pen can display 'fit', the pen can display 'light' or 'too light' when the weight is less than 50 g, and the pen can display 'too heavy' when the weight is more than 150 g, and the display is not limited to this, and the pen can remind a user through symbols or other words. It is emphasized that the weight value is not limited thereto, and may also be set for adults or persons having different habits with pens.
In an embodiment of the present invention, the reminding may be realized by a voice of the smart pen, and the voice may be a simple voice prompt, or may be a voice prompt that is played with a display screen in cooperation with the display screen, or a simple warning sound is played directly for prompting, which is not limited herein.
In an embodiment of the invention, the smart pen is an automatic retractable smart pen, and when the stress of the film pressure sensor acquisition pen core exceeds a first preset value, the smart pen controls the pen core to retract. In this embodiment, the first predetermined value may be 150 grams, but is not limited thereto, and the first predetermined value may range from "145 to 160 grams". It is emphasized that the weight value is not limited thereto, and the first predetermined value may also be set for adults or persons having different habits with pens.
In one embodiment of the invention, when the stress of the film pressure sensor acquisition pen core is smaller than a first preset value and larger than a second preset value, the intelligent pen controls the pen core to complete stretching and contracting actions of 2-5 mm, so that a user can feel sinking instantly when using the intelligent pen, and then the intelligent pen returns to normal to prompt the user, so that the writing of the user is not interrupted, and the prompt effect on the sense of the body limbs is achieved.
In order to better enable the user to master writing, in an embodiment of the invention, when the beginner starts to use the pen, the range of the force is tested by pressing the pen head, and the user can find out the sense of the correct force according to the prompt.
